About this part

The exhaust on your Softail Deluxe 1450cc routes gases away from the engine, reduces noise and controls emissions. Corrosion, impacts or failed joints cause leaks that make the vehicle louder and increase emissions.

Frequently asked questions

What should I consider when buying exhaust parts for the Harley-Davidson Softail Deluxe 1450cc?

Exhaust components are vehicle-specific – match the engine variant and model year of your Softail Deluxe 1450cc. Check whether gaskets and mounting hardware are included.

Should I choose OEM or aftermarket exhaust parts?

OEM parts guarantee correct fit and sound levels. Quality aftermarket stainless steel parts can last longer in corrosive conditions and may offer a sportier tone.
